Calycanthus floridus

Common Sweetshrub or Carolina Allspice

A lush, deciduous native flowering shrub that produces a fragrant, maroon, spike-like blossom with a yellow center in May.  It is trouble-free, transplants well, and makes an excellent addition to the shrub border.
Zone 4 8'x8'

Carpinus caroliniana

American Hornbeam

Interesting native tree with a "muscled" appearance in the trunk and branching. Transplants best in Spring. Good for wet sites. Blue-green foliage, turning orange-scarlet in the Fall.

Cornus x "Rutban"

"Aurora®" White Flowering Dogwood

(P.P. #7205)  This Rutgers Hybrid has an abundance of white flowers with an upright growth habit.  All of the Dogwoods from the Rutger Series are resistant to the common Dogwood diseases.
B&B 8'-10'    
Zone 5 20'x20'      

Cornus x "Rutdan"

"Celestial®" White Flowering Dogwood

P.P. #7204)  One of the Rutgers Series, developed by crossing our Native Flowering Dogwood with the Kousa Dogwood.  The result is a plant that shows better resistance to Anthracnose and Borers.  The bloom period is later than Cornus florida.
B&B 5'-6' B&B 7'-8'
Zone 5 20'x20' B&B 6'-7' B&B 8'-10'

Cornus x "Rutgan"

"Stellar Pink®" Dogwood

(P.P. 7207)  Another Rutgers Series Dogwood with great disease resistance.  This variety is a vigorous grower with pink blossoms.
